Output 3dd7637e18b0d514cef73b19063aad6da6204fe8fca7d61e0342f2975b496f1c:4

value
586113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f88683e7de775b7f474beb38b8de339c2beec3 OP_EQUAL
address
33y3rzsrGSznwz4R2pFKnfjcTxA3B5XiT7
transaction
3dd7637e18b0d514cef73b19063aad6da6204fe8fca7d61e0342f2975b496f1c
spent
true